Finely detailed Spanish Renaissance bronze plaquette, early 17th century

Finely detailed Spanish early 17th century Renaissance gilt wax-cast and chased bronze plaquette depicting Saint Peter as a Penitent, Attributed to the Master of the Penitent Saints, Spain. Suspension loop missing. Inscribed "N" on reverse.

Reference: See Ashmolean Museum Collection, Oxford (WA1897.CDEF.B864) for slightly larger version

This plaque depicts Saint Peter in penitent attitude, with the rooster beside him and the keys to heaven in front. After the Last Supper, Jesus predicted that Peter would deny him three times that night before a rooster crowed. Despite his earlier declarations of loyalty, Peter did deny Jesus three times as predicted. The two large keys represent the ministry of authority that Jesus entrusted to Peter in the service of the church.

Borghese Gladiator Bronze Sculpture After the Antique, Inscribed 'G. HOPFGARTEN. ROMA. 1862'

Bronze sculpture after the antique, inscribed "G. HOPFGARTEN. ROMA. 1862" on base.  This is a copy after the Borghese Gladiator, a Hellenistic life-size marble sculpture portraying a swordsman battling a mounted combatant, created in about 100 BC. The name comes from the Borghese Villa in Rome, where it stood in a ground floor room named for it.  It was sold by Camillo Borghese to his brother In-law Napoleon Bonaparte and taken to Paris and added to the Louvre collection where it still resides.

Alfred Boucher (French 1850-1934)' Au But! (To the Goal!)' Bronze

Alfred Boucher (French 1850-1934)

Au But! (To the Goal!)
bronze, inscribed on base "A. Boucher" and with foundry mark "Siot-Decauville Fondeur Paris ** 7742"
Boucher's first great success was achieved in 1886 with the plaster version of Au But (To The Goal!), otherwise known as Les Coureurs, which was exhibited at the Salon of 1886 and won a first class medal. Many critics commended the sculptor’s talent and Paul Leroi wrote of the piece in L’Art, “a plaster group with an extreme vigour, an admirable intensity of life, the greatest movement, and a rare suppleness of modelling, in short, one of the masterpieces which honours French art.” The three nude runners are just at the goal and intensely struggling; a most difficult theme executed with the greatest of skill. The state awarded Boucher the Chevalier de la Legion d’Honneur and commissioned a life-size bronze version of Au But. The finished cast was exhibited at the Salon in 1887 (no. 3675), before being placed in the Luxembourg Gardens, where it remained until, sadly, being destroyed during the Nazi occupation. Such was the popularity of this work, it was edited in many different sizes, and by numerous foundries, including Barbedienne, Susse and Siot-Decauville.
